Convolutional Neural Network Emulators for DGVMs - A Supervised Machine Learning Approach to Big Data Processing

This paper investigates the possibility to train a convolutional neural network (CNN) that, by capturing temporal features in weather data, can estimate the expected amount of wheat produced during any year, at any geographical location. A deep learning approach for predicting outcomes of triple-negative breast cancer

Breast cancer is the most common cancer in women. Triple-negative breast cancer affects 10-20% of breast cancer patients and is associated with an especially bad prognosis. Today, tissue slides are assessed manually by a clinician to set a prognosis. However, the prediction of outcomes could possibly be improved using machine learning. Improved Accuracy for Indoor Positioning with Bluetooth 5.1: From Theory to Measurements

In this thesis we are evaluating Bluetooth Low Energy (BLE) v5.1 in combination with Direction Of Arrival (DOA) algorithms and receiving antenna arrays for indoor positioning systems. The thesis is divided in two parts. The first part is the core of the thesis and is composed by the evaluation of DOA algorithms in a direction finding system. The purpose of the thesis was to investigate how usability is included when purchasing operational systems within the Swedish municipal health care sector. Systems, which are perceived as usable by the users, may cause the daily tasks to be executed more efficiently and effectively. Consequently, the municipalities can save time and money. Application of convolutional neural networks for fingerprint recognition

Fingerprint recognition is a well-known problem in pattern recognition and widely used in contemporary authentication technology such as access devices in mobile phones. The subject of this thesis is to investigate the applicability of convolutional neural networks for fingerprint recognition. Analog and Digital Signal Processing in an Optical Application

The thesis consists of two parts. Registration of Digital Images: Registration of images is a fundamental task in image processing. This is to match two or more images taken, for example, at different times, from different sensors or from different points of view. Classifying Sensor Data Using Recurrent Neural Networks

Nearly 40 percent of overall energy usage in the European Union is used by buildings and 85 percent of that is for heating and cooling them[4]. This massive amount of energy is thought to be able to be lowered by introducing smarter control of the building systems. Technology to do this is continuously being developed and improved. Aerodynamic design of a gas turbine rotor blade for the KTH test turbine

The purpose of the thesis was to design a new rotor blade for the KTH test turbine according to present design guidelines for gas turbines manufactured at Siemens Industrial Turbomachinery in Finspång. Hybrid Mobile Application Development Using an Existing Web Application

Mobile applications are today an important way for companies to reach their customers. Developing a mobile application could require a lot of resources, especially if the application is to be made from scratch. Evaluating PalCom as an Internet of Things Platform

Palpable computing is a new research topic that has been developed to solve some of the issues found with the original way of looking at pervasive computing. The research into this topic has, among other things, resulted in a middleware called PalCom. Characterization of LDPE-film by Experiments and Simulations

In this thesis, the mechanical properties of thin films of low density polyethylene were investigated. There were three main objectives: to perform experiments, to simulate the experiments in Abaqus and to identify material parameters for some constitutive models by optimization. Miniaturized antennas for link between binaural hearing aids

We have investigated the possibility of using the 2.45 GHz ISM band for communication between binaural hearing aids. The small size of a modern hearing aid makes it necessary to miniaturize the antennas to make this feasible.
